3. Web development and Design
The need for websites is ever-growing, making web development skills a lucrative asset. College students can learn to build and design websites, offering their services to businesses, startups, or individual clients.

Why it’s beneficial:
- High earning potential exists as a freelancer or part-time developer.
- Opportunities to learn in-demand coding languages like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Python.
- Ability to showcase skills through personal projects and portfolios can greatly enhance job prospects.
Recommended courses:
- The Web Developer Bootcamp 2023 (Udemy)
- Responsive Web Design (FreeCodeCamp)

6. E-commerce and Dropshipping
E-commerce has transformed how businesses operate, with platforms like Shopify, Etsy, and Amazon allowing anyone to set up an online store. Dropshipping, in particular, eliminates the need for inventory, making it a beginner-friendly option.

Why it’s beneficial:
- Low startup costs and minimal risk make it an attractive option for students.
- Ideal for entrepreneurial-minded students who want to learn about business management.
- Opportunity to learn valuable skills such as product research, customer service, and branding. Recommended courses:
- Build a Shopify Dropshipping Business from Scratch (Udemy)
- Ecommerce Essentials: How to Start a Successful Online Business (Skillshare)

8. Virtual Assistance and Administrative Skills
Many businesses and entrepreneurs hire virtual assistants (VAs) to handle administrative tasks like email management, scheduling, and data entry. With minimal training, students can start earning money as a VA.
Why it’s beneficial:
Easy to start with basic organizational skills, making it accessible for many students.
Flexible work hours and remote opportunities are ideal for busy students.
Chance to learn other skills while assisting professionals can enhance growth. Recommended courses:
Become a Virtual Assistant (Udemy)
Virtual Assistant Training: How to Work from Home as a VA (Skillshare)
